Abstract
This paper proposes a Hierarchical Region Matching (HRM) approach for computer-assisted auto coloring. The region-level analysis in traditional 2D animation is expanded into several component levels with a novel hierarchization method. With the hierarchy, various region matching algorithms can be applied from the first/highest to the last/lowest component level. HRM improves the matching accuracy and may deal with matching errors caused by occlusion, thus making the matching more robust, as verified by the results
